      Genetic DNA paternity testing requires the testing of a Y chromosome from a male descendant of the subject because the Y chromosome in males remains virtually unchanged from generation to generation.
      But Thomas Jefferson had no male descendant s from which to take a DNA sample. His only son had died at birth.
      Since Jefferson had no male descendants
      ,researchers chose to test the Y chromosome from the descendants of Field Jefferson, Thomas’s uncle.
      Researchers found that the configuration of the Y chromosome in the descendants of Field Jefferson- a general configuration common to the entire Jefferson family-was indeed present in the descendants of sally Hemings youngest child , Easton.
      Therefore on the basis of DNA testing the most that the researchers could conclusively say was that some Jefferson
      Male and there were 26 Jefferson males living in the area at the time!
      -Herbert Barger,the Jefferson family historian and genealogist who assisted in the DNA testing,explained:my study indicates to me that Thomas Jefferson was NOT the father of Easton or any other
      Himmings child. The DNA study... indicates that Randolph [Thomas’younger brother]is possibly the father of Easton and maybe the others...three of sally Hemings children,Harriet,Beverly,and Easton (the latter two not common names), were given names of the Randolph family.
      -the Scholars ‘ commission arrived at the same conclusion.significantly, that group had not been composed of Jefferson supporters ; in fact, several of the scholars had believed that Jefferson might be the father of hemings’children.
      But after a year investigating the evidence they all concluded that Randolph , Jefferson ‘s younger brother was indeed the most likely father,explaining:
      The circumstantial case that Easton Hemings was fathered by the president’s
      Younger brother is many times stronger than the case against the president himself.among the considerations which might point to Randolph are:
      -In”memoirs of a Monticello Slave” former slave Isaac Jefferson asserts that when Randolph Jefferson visited Monticello,he “used to come out among black people,and play fiddle and dance half the night...” in contrast, we have not
      A single account of Thomas Jefferson spending his nights socializing with the slaves in such a manner
      - we have Jefferson s letter inviting Randolph to come to Monticello shortly before Sally became pregnant with Easton. It was common for such visits to last for weeks!

    "Sally Hemings came to Jefferson's home as an infant with her mother and siblings as part of his wife Martha's inheritance of slaves from her father. Hemings was the youngest of six siblings by the widowed planter John Wayles (slave trader) and Betty Hemings, a mixed-race enslaved woman; Sally and her siblings were three-quarters European, and through their father were also half-siblings of Martha Jefferson.[3] In 1787, Hemings, aged 14,[1] accompanied Jefferson's youngest daughter Mary("Polly") to London and then to Paris, where the widowed Jefferson, aged 44 at the time, was serving as the United States Minister to France. Hemings spent two years there. It is believed by most historians that Jefferson began a sexual relationship with Hemings in France or soon after their return to Monticello.[2] Hemings remained enslaved in Jefferson's house until his death. In 2017 a room identified as her quarters at Monticello, adjacent to Jefferson's bedroom, was discovered in an archeological restoration. It will be restored and refurbished.[4][5]
    The historical question of whether Jefferson was the father of Hemings' children is known as the Jefferson-Hemings controversy. Following renewed historic analysis in the late 20th century and a 1998 DNA study that found a match between the Jefferson male line and a descendant of Hemings' last son, Eston Hemings, there is a consensus among historians that Jefferson fathered her son Eston Hemings and probably all her children.[6]A small number of historians disagree.[7]
    Hemings' children lived in Jefferson's house as slaves and were trained as artisans. Jefferson freed all of Hemings' surviving children: Beverly, Harriet, Madison, and Eston, as they came of age (they were the only slave family freed by Jefferson). They were seven-eighths European in ancestry, and three of the four entered white society as adults. Descendants of those three identified as white.[8][9] Hemings was "given her time," and lived her last nine years freely with her two younger sons in Charlottesville, Virginia. She saw a grandchild born in the house her sons owned.[10]"
